Drew Pereira serves as a Postdoctoral Researcher in Materials Science at the National Renewable Energy Laboratory (NREL), leading research for the U.S. Department of Energy's Behind-the-Meter Storage Consortium. His work focuses on developing novel battery chemistries emphasizing high safety, durability, and cost-effectiveness for energy storage systems through advanced materials selection and characterization.
Education:
- PhD in Chemical Engineering, University of South Carolina
- Bachelor of Chemical Engineering, Missouri University of Science and Technology
Research Interests:
Pereira's core expertise spans battery electrode and electrolyte development, advanced materials characterization techniques, computational battery modeling, and scalable manufacturing processes. His investigations target critical challenges in lithium-ion battery technology, particularly for behind-the-meter storage applications requiring extended cycle life and thermal stability. Current projects emphasize nonflammable electrolytes, cathode heterogeneity analysis, and performance optimization under real-world operating conditions.
Research Output Trends:
His 2022-2025 publications reveal a concentrated focus on electrolyte engineering and degradation mechanisms in lithium-titanate/LiNiMnCo oxide batteries. Key themes include solvent effects on cycle life, cutoff potential optimization, nonflammable electrolyte formulations, and microstructural aging analysis using advanced characterization. This body of work consistently addresses the consortium's mission to enable safe, long-duration storage for grid integration and commercial deployment.
Scientific Awards:
- Office of Science Graduate Student Research Fellowship (2020)
Professional Background and Collaborations:
Prior to his NREL appointment, Pereira served as Research and Development Manager at Soteria Battery Innovation Group (2021-2023) and completed a DOE Office of Science Graduate Fellowship at NREL (2020-2021). His industry experience includes cell modeling work at General Motors (2018-2019). Current research involves extensive collaboration across NREL's materials science division and external partners within the DOE consortium, with projects funded through the Behind-the-Meter Storage initiative. His laboratory work integrates electrochemical testing, electron microscopy, and multi-scale modeling to validate next-generation battery systems.
